

Yasu, who you’ll remember as the Japanese programmer to first demonstrate that running homebrew software is possible on the DSi, has released several PC tools designed to help with trading and editing Made in Ore microgames.
MIOtool - Export specific user-created microgames, music, and comics from a standard save file (of course, to get a Made in Ore save file onto your PC, you’ll either need a ROM/flashcart or a device like this), outputting a .mio file. You can also import .mio files into your save with this.
MML2MIO - Convert ML scripts (Music Macro Language) into Made in Ore music tracks.
MIOedit - Open .mio files to view and replace graphical elements. From what I understand, you can drop in sprites created in external applications like Photoshop.

Yasu, the same programmer who was able to run unofficial code on the DSi despite Nintendo’s anti-piracy measures, has put up a video showing the new handheld playing Pop’n DS, a rhythm title based on Konami’s Bemani series.
It’s not clear whether he’s running the homemade game through a flashcart or an SD card, but some claim that Yasu is using a “save game exploit,” which Nintendo could potentially patch with future firmware upgrades.
There are supposedly three known save game exploits, all of which can play homebrew games and applications, but not commercial titles. Several groups are actively searching for more possible exploits.
I’ve been meaning to write about Pop’n DS for a while, as it’s great stuff, but I kept forgetting to! You can download the game from Yasu’s Japanese site to play it on a Nintendo DS Lite/Phat.
